Ferus Smit has received an order for 4 mini bulkers from the Irish / Rotterdam based Arklow Shipping. The first two are planned for delivery in the second half of the 2018 with the other two following in May and November 2019

Spec's are for 16,500dwt Eco bulk carriers at 149.5 meters loa and a beam of 19.4 meters.

As new tonnage for Arklow hits the water currently such as the Arklow Cape and Arklow Valley in the 5000dwt sector, older tonnage is rumured to be preparing to look for buyers. Already the Arklow Rose (blt 2002) has been sold on to Welsh owner Charles M Willie and renamed Celtic Venture.

Further to the above it has been reported the Arklow Wave (blt 2003) has been purchased by Nova Marine Carriers SA and renamed NACC Toronto this November. No doubt with the recent Carisbrooke Shipping tie up Nova Marine Carriers are sourcing similar tonnage. The Arklow Wave is a gearless sister to Carisbrooke's 13,400dwt vessels such as Amy C, Heleen C etc.

Arklow Wave's sister, Arklow Willow (blt 2004) was previously sold this year to the Canadian company McKeil Marine for operating within the Great Lakes being named Florence Spirit.

Mv Odertal (Blt 2007, Imo 9404235) has been bought by Scotline and named Scot Leader. Delivery was in Hull and she proceeded to dry dock, now sporting the Scotline grey hull / green hatch.

A few updates recently in the UK market:

Arklow Wave (imo 9287314) - Now Longwave (Arklow sold to Norway based owners. Longship acting as Management)

Sea Melody (imo 9006382) sold to Turkish owners - Renamed My Melody

Arklow Rally (imo 9250414) - Reported as sold to Charles M Willie (tbn Celtic Freedom)

Victress (imo 9030498) - Sold to Med owners, named Redon

Islay Trader (imo 9030474) - Sold by Faversham to SeaG8 (Replaces Pluto)

Pluto (imo 8415665) - Sold by SeaG8 to Hav Ship Management - Renamed Baltica Hav

Scot Carrier (imo 9137208) - Sold by Scotline to Faversham - renamed Victress
